Ok. If you are truly looking for feedback on a website that ostensibly promotes you as a paid presenter, here is mine.

That website does NOT promote you as a paid presenter, IMO. It is a general promotional website for your books, mostly the Ghost Orchid one. The sidebar with your presentation info is at the bottom of the page, only reached with much scrolling, and buried in irrelevancies like "newest members." Even the link in the header is just one of many.

I would completely revamp that page to make it obvious you are available as a paid presenter, or even better, make a separate, dedicated page for that. I would put more rounded resume experience on that page as justification for why you should be hired for the various categories you listed instead of such an overwhelming amount of promotional info about one book. The bio is completely inadequate. I would not hire someone to speak on winning workplaces, finding your best self, etc., based on a bio telling me little more than your hobbies and favorite local haunts.

I've got more, but I think you get the point.

DK, I think the best place to start is by looking at other speakers' webpages. Like this guy's:

http://www.larryjacobson.com/

His book is featured, sure, but it's as a support to why you'd want to hire him. Pattern your page and bio after his. You've got stuff to put. You sailed with your family for years, lived by yourself on a boat for years (very unusual), worked as a school administrator, an intern in Congress, etc., etc. ...put that in your bio, like this guy did.

He's got a nice picture of himself, a video -he's selling himself. Your website is selling your books. Keep your promotional books site, sure, but make a new one that sells you.
